The Position: We’re looking for a Part time Adult Support Tutor (15 hours per week – Term Time)

Requirements for the role:

  • To be part of a quality Learning Support Team, and to provide support and assistance to identified students to enable them to access both the academic and wider college curriculum working with mainstream and discrete groups. 
  • To facilitate small group sessions for 3 to 4 learners

Responsibilities for the role:

  • Provide high quality academic support that enables students to achieve identified goals. To keep students to task and promote learning
  • Developing an understanding of specific needs of the learner(s) taking into account the type of teaching and learning support involved.
  • Contribute to the planning of learning support that is inclusive and meets curriculum requirements

North Warwickshire and South Leicestershire College (NWSLC) is a large Further Education college offering a wide range of full-time, part-time, Higher Education and Apprenticeship programmes over six campuses based within Warwickshire and Leicestershire.

The College also works with over 600 businesses across a wide range of sectors – working with organisations to determine their ‘training needs analysis’. We then design a programme to match your (the employer’s) requirements.
